72 Maitland Street, Glasgow. G4 0DQ. Demolished. There has been a pub on this site since at least the 1840s. In 1875 John Paterson was landlord, he also owned a pub in 5 Monkland Street. James Shanks owned the pub in the 1890s, Mr Shanks was a well established wine & spirit merchant having pubs […]
